The Pennsylvania Department of Corrections is hiring a Wastewater Treatment Plant Foreman at the State Correctional Institution in Mercer. You'll support essential wastewater operations for the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ania , with a predictable schedule, strong benefits, and a clear path to retirement. What You'll Be Responsible For Leading daily operation of a wastewater treatment plant Operating and maintaining equipment such as pumps, motors, valves, filters, aerators, and chlorinators Performing sampling and chemical testing to support compliance Scheduling work and reviewing completed tasks Supervising and training an inmate work crew in a secure setting Maintaining logs, records, and inventory Supporting safe operations during routine and emergency conditions What You Need to Qualify Minimum Experience One year of experience operating and maintaining a wastewater treatment plant Required Certifications & Licenses Valid certifications from the Pennsylvania State Board for
Certification of Water and Wastewater Systems Operators:
Class C or higher and Class E Valid Pennsylvania non-commercial Class C driver's license or equivalent Veterans Are Encouraged to Apply Eligible veterans may receive: Veterans' Preference in hiring for Commonwealth positions Paid military leave for Guard and Reserve service The option to purchase qualifying military service time toward retirement Important to Know This position is located inside a correctional facility You will supervise inmate workers as part of daily operations Interviews must be self-scheduled online after applying Watch your email (and spam folder) for next steps Ready When You Are If you're ready for a dependable role with leadership responsibility and long-term benefits, this opportunity delivers.
